Crackdown on Crypto Miners in Thailand Leads to Seizures and Arrests

Crypto mining involves extracting cryptocurrency, such as Bitcoin, and comes with challenges like post-halving impacts, hash rate issues, significant investments, and high electricity consumption. The issue of electricity theft by Bitcoin miners has been a concern, leading to crackdowns in various countries.

In a recent incident in Thailand, authorities seized Bitcoin mining tools valued at $5 million and arrested three individuals for overseeing illegal crypto mining activities. This highlights the significance of understanding the basics of crypto mining and the energy consumption involved.

Electricity Consumption in Crypto Mining

Crypto mining demands a substantial amount of electricity, with global estimates ranging from 67 TWh to 240 TWh, emphasizing the energy-intensive nature of the process. Mining operations rely on powerful computers to solve complex mathematical puzzles, essential for verifying blockchain transactions. However, the energy requirements have raised environmental sustainability questions, especially in regions with inexpensive electricity.

Recent Development in Thailand

Thai authorities conducted a raid in Samut Sakhon, where they confiscated 187 mining devices within a temple compound. Subsequently, in Ratchaburi, a separate warehouse revealed 465 devices connected to the illegal operation. The total value of the seized equipment surpassed 200 million baht, indicating the scale of the illicit activities.

Investigations uncovered tampered electricity meters, suggesting theft amounting to 5 million baht. Three suspects, identified as Sombat Tangnawadee, Kiatkongel Tumthong, and Somwang, were arrested for managing the unauthorized mining operations. They confessed to importing equipment from China for resale and providing hosting services for a fee.

This crackdown in Thailand echoes global efforts to address illegal crypto mining practices. Other countries like Russia and Malaysia have also taken action against miners involved in electricity theft.

Conclusion

The crackdown emphasizes the importance of tighter regulations and monitoring to prevent electricity theft and environmental damage in the crypto mining sector. Employing greener energy sources and more efficient technologies can promote sustainable practices within the industry. It is crucial for miners to align their operations with sustainability goals to foster responsible growth in the crypto ecosystem and avoid legal repercussions.
